[0001] This invention relates to the field of heterogeneous material diffusion welding technology, and in particular to a method, system, electronic device and storage medium for optimizing hot isostatic pressure diffusion welding parameters based on deep learning. Background Technology

[0002] Hot isostatic pressing (HIP) is a technique used in fusion reactors like EAST, where tungsten copper and chromium zirconium copper are commonly used composite structural materials due to their excellent thermal, electrical, and mechanical properties. However, traditional welding methods suffer from problems such as porous structure, high interfacial thermal resistance, and microcracks at the weld joint, severely impacting service life. HIP, with its high density and strong interfacial bonding, is considered an ideal joining process. In the field of heterogeneous material diffusion welding, existing patents on HIP diffusion welding mainly focus on methods and steps for welding different metals, with few addressing systematic optimization of the process parameters.

[0003] However, existing hot isostatic pressure diffusion welding technology has obvious limitations: the determination of hot isostatic pressure welding parameters for tungsten copper and chromium zirconium copper mostly relies on the experience of technicians or a large number of trial and error experiments. During the parameter adjustment process, only one or a few parameters such as temperature, pressure, and holding time are tested, lacking a comprehensive consideration of the interaction between multiple parameters. At the same time, the performance evaluation of the welded joint needs to be carried out through actual tests such as tensile strength testing and microstructure observation after welding. The whole process lacks effective pre-prediction and dynamic optimization methods. Summary of the Invention

[0004] To overcome the shortcomings of existing technologies, the purpose of this invention is to provide a method, system, electronic device, and storage medium for optimizing hot isostatic pressure diffusion welding parameters based on deep learning, which solves the problems of traditional methods relying too much on human experience or trial-and-error experiments and lacking dynamic optimization methods.

[0116] Specifically, this embodiment provides a method for optimizing hot isostatic pressure diffusion welding parameters. First, a hot isostatic pressure diffusion physical model is constructed. Then, multiple sets of experiments are set up to extract the error between the physical model output and the actual measured values, thereby constructing an error compensation model. The physical model and the compensation model are then fused to obtain a result prediction model. Subsequently, a PID controller is used to iteratively optimize the parameters to find the optimal parameter combination. During model construction, not only welding process-related parameters but also the material's own property parameters must be considered.

[0117] Preferably, hot isostatic pressure diffusion welding mainly promotes atomic diffusion, porosity elimination, and joint densification at the interface of the materials to be welded through the synergistic effect of high temperature and isostatic pressure. Based on this, the physical model of this embodiment integrates diffusion kinetics, interfacial thermodynamics, and pressure-densification coupling processes, and combines process parameters and material properties to achieve theoretical prediction of the welding effect. Before simulation, it is necessary to determine the values ​​of some parameters, including diffusion activation energy, diffusion constant, welding temperature, holding time, initial interface concentration, and interface roughness. Referring to existing literature, the expressions of the HIP diffusion welding physical model constructed in this embodiment include:

[0131] Specifically, the following description uses hot isostatic pressing (HIP) diffusion welding of tungsten copper and chromium zirconium copper as a specific example. Process parameters related to HIP diffusion welding are selected, and reasonable value ranges are set based on material properties. These parameters include HIP temperature, HIP pressure, holding time, heating rate, and cooling rate. Material property parameters of tungsten copper and chromium zirconium copper are determined, including diffusion constant, diffusion activation energy, and material constants. An experimental scheme is constructed using orthogonal experimental design, and the scheme is sequentially input into the HIP diffusion physical model for simulation. Theoretical prediction results are output, including tensile strength, thermal diffusivity, porosity, and residual stress.

[0132] Furthermore, tungsten-copper and chromium-zirconium-copper base materials matching the material property parameters in the experimental scheme were selected, and the base material size specifications were standardized, with dimensions set to 50mm to 100mm in length, 30mm to 50mm in width, and 5mm to 10mm in thickness. The base materials were cut using a wire cutting device, and the welding interface of the samples to be welded was subjected to gradient grinding, using 800-grit, 1200-grit, and 2000-grit silicon carbide sandpaper in sequence, and a mechanical grinder was used for grinding until the interface roughness was no greater than 0.8μm. The ground samples were placed in an ultrasonic cleaning tank, using anhydrous ethanol as the cleaning agent, and ultrasonic cleaning was performed after setting the ultrasonic power and cleaning time to remove residual grinding debris and oil stains at the interface. The rinsed samples were placed in a vacuum drying oven and thoroughly dried at a constant temperature.

[0133] Optionally, before conducting the experiment, the hot isostatic pressing (HIP) equipment needs to be precisely calibrated. Three to five temperature measuring points should be evenly arranged within the furnace cavity, with the calibration temperature range covering the HIP temperature set in the experimental design. A standard pressure sensor should be used to calibrate the pressure range covering the HIP pressure set in the experimental design. The heating and cooling rates should be calibrated using a temperature acquisition instrument, and the pressure increase rate should be calibrated using a pressure acquisition instrument. A graphite fixture compatible with the sample material should be selected, and the pretreated experimental sample should be fixed inside the fixture. The fixture and sample should be placed together into the HIP furnace cavity. After closing the furnace door, the vacuum system should be activated to evacuate the furnace cavity. The heating rate of the equipment was controlled according to the experimental plan. When the temperature inside the furnace reached 90% of the target hot isostatic pressure temperature, the pressure system was started, and the pressure was slowly increased to the target pressure at the set pressure increase rate. After the temperature and pressure reached the values ​​set in the experimental plan, the heat preservation and pressure holding stage was entered. During this stage, the temperature and pressure of each temperature measuring point in the furnace were monitored in real time to ensure that the parameter fluctuations were within the calibration accuracy range. The heat preservation and pressure holding time was executed according to the experimental plan. After the heat preservation and pressure holding was completed, the temperature was reduced according to the cooling rate set in the experimental plan. After the temperature dropped below 50°C and the pressure dropped to normal pressure, the furnace was opened and the welded sample was taken out.

[0135] Specifically, this embodiment improves upon the original MLP model. The improved MLP model in this embodiment includes an input layer, a weighted preprocessing layer, a hidden layer, and an output layer connected in sequence. The function of each network layer is as follows:

[0136] 1) Input layer: Receives and preprocesses the original training data, which includes experimental scheme parameters, theoretical prediction results, and theoretical and actual error data. Before input, the data needs to be processed by Min-Max normalization to map the feature values ​​to the interval [0, 1].

[0137] 2) Weighted preprocessing layer: Used to extract the coupling relationships between different features in the original data. [0140] Iterate through all feature pairs to generate a weighted interactive dataset.

[0141] 3) Hidden layer: It consists of two fully connected layers connected in sequence. The number of neurons in the first fully connected layer is set to twice the sum of the original input features and the weighted interaction features. The number of neurons in the second fully connected layer is set to half that of the first layer.

[0142] 4) Output layer: The number of neurons is consistent with the number of indicators in the theoretical and actual error data (in this embodiment, the number of neurons in the output layer is 4, corresponding to tensile strength, thermal diffusivity, porosity and residual stress respectively), and finally outputs the multi-indicator error compensation values ​​predicted by the model.

[0149] Based on experience with hot isostatic pressing (HIP), initial values ​​for the proportional coefficient, integral coefficient, and derivative coefficient are set, and parameter adjustment constraints, i.e., parameter boundaries, are defined. If the overall control deviation is less than the maximum allowable deviation and the overall control deviation remains stable below the maximum allowable deviation for three consecutive iterations, it is determined that the preset requirements are met, and the iteration stops; if the overall control deviation is greater than the maximum allowable deviation, it is determined that the preset requirements are not met, and parameter adjustment is required.
